City of Anderson to launch 'First Fridays' this week

ANDERSON, Ind. -- It’s an idea that’s been years in the making and now the City of Anderson is launching its inaugural First Friday Art Walk.

The event is organized by A Town Center, Inc.  

“We have been anticipating First Friday events for years,” says program director Sonia Caldwell. “Now that we have met all building requirements and our doors are finally open, we can host First Fridays and encourage everyone to walk Downtown and see that Anderson is a great place to live, shop, eat, drink and have fun.”

Levi Rinker with the Anderson Economic Development Office agrees with Caldwell. “The idea is to show Anderson as a more playful environment with a vibrant Artisan community.  The Indianapolis Metro area is growing, and more young people are moving to Anderson and they shouldn’t have to drive to Indy to enjoy a vibrant nightlife.”

The kickoff event is scheduled for Friday, June 1 at 5 p.m.

The “First” First Friday will include eight venues throughout Downtown Anderson. 

The Anderson Museum of Art will extend their gallery hours until 8 pm. and some businesses will offer food and drink specials. 

First Fridays will continue throughout the year.
